There were no obvious injuries for the Warriors and they should have almost a full squad to pick from for their opening game of the season against the Rabbitohs in Perth in a fortnight.
The match began in hot and humid conditions and the Titans opened the scoring when halfback Ash Taylor got to a rebounded kick first in the in-goal.
The Warrior answered through David Fusitua in the corner before Solomone Kata took advantage of an overlap to put the visitors in front.
Fusitua added a second try early in the second half before Titans winger Tyrone Roberts-Davis bagged a double in the final quarter of the match, when heavy rain swept across the ground.
Rookie hooker Sam Cook scored a try for the Warriors in between Roberts-Davis' tries.
